Three-phase slicers are professional machines for precise slicing of cured meats, hams, cheeses and other food products intended for high-intensity processing contexts. Their main feature is the 400V three-phase power supply, designed for professional environments that require operating continuity, working stability and constant performance during prolonged slicing cycles. Compared to slicers intended for lighter tasks, these models are designed for users who work at sustained rhythms and require a solid machine, suitable for frequent and repeated production.
Operation is based on the rotation of the blade and the movement of the carriage, which guides the product towards the cutting surface. In gravity slicers, the inclined plane helps the food move towards the blade; in vertical slicers, the blade is positioned perpendicular to the plane and the operator manually moves the product to be sliced. Standard versions instead feature a classic machine body structure, suitable for traditional professional configurations.
Three-phase slicers are intended for catering professionals, delicatessens, food laboratories, butcher shops and businesses that require uniform slices, orderly cutting and a good aesthetic result on the processed product. The presence of a 320 mm or larger blade, anodized aluminium base and removable components makes these machines suitable for operations where precision, cleaning and routine maintenance directly affect service quality.

- Slicer type: gravity slicers have an inclined plane that guides the product towards the blade and makes cutting easier. Vertical slicers instead feature the blade in a perpendicular position to the plane, with manual movement of the product by the operator; standard slicers keep a traditional machine body structure;
- 400V three-phase power supply: all machines in this selection are powered by 400V three-phase current. This configuration makes the product suitable for professional contexts and activities that require continuous operation;
- Removable components: the removable blade cover plate can be fixed with a front screw or a rear knob, allowing it to be removed. The removable carriage allows the surface on which food is placed to be separated, making machine cleaning and maintenance easier;
- Professional CE certification: professional CE certification identifies models intended for professional use. This aspect is relevant for food businesses that require machines suited to a regulated working environment;
- 320 mm and larger blade: a blade diameter of 320 mm and above allows large products to be processed. A wide blade supports regular and orderly cuts on bulky food products;
- Grey housing colour: the grey housing gives the machine a sober appearance suited to professional environments. The finish integrates easily into laboratories, delicatessens and operational kitchens;
- Anodized aluminium base: anodized aluminium is a suitable material for this type of application, as it resists corrosion and solvents. The base contributes to the machine's sturdiness and supports frequent use;
